5 SANDOWN CRESCENT is a very small semi-detached house of 61m², built sometime between 1983 and 1990, which could now be worth an estimated £326,236. It was last sold for £268,000 in November 2019, which was around 16% below the average November 2019 semi-detached price in the Rushmoor local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was August 2019,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

What might 5 SANDOWN CRESCENT be worth now?

5 SANDOWN CRESCENT might now be worth an estimated £326,236.

This is based on house price inflation of 21.7%, between November 2019 and March 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the Rushmoor local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 21.7%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 5 SANDOWN CRESCENT of £268,000 on 27th November 2019. For the value to have increased from £268,000 to £326,236 over the six years and eight months to March 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 5 SANDOWN CRESCENT has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the Rushmoor local authority area.
  • The November 2019 sale price of £268,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 5 SANDOWN CRESCENT has not materially changed since November 2019.
